Why Entity Optimisation Is Important


Entity optimisation means making a brand, service, product, or topic properly recognisable as a recognised concept. For AI search, this is especially important. If a business wants to be associated with an AI search platform, AI visibility, or ranking in ChatGPT answers, its content should clearly cover these areas. The brand should have a clear identity, a specific role, and close topic relevance.

Entity optimisation also involves removing unclear signals. A business should use uniform naming, descriptions, topic categories, and solution details. When information is inconsistent or poorly explained, AI systems may not clearly link the brand with a specific search intent. When the information is structured and repeated naturally across relevant content, the connection becomes more reliable.

Tracking Competitors in AI Answers


Competitor tracking is another reason businesses use an AI search ranking tool. In traditional search, companies track positions for keywords. In AI search, they may need to track which brands show up in AI results, what language is used to present them, what topics they lead, and where they are missing. This type of analysis can show useful gaps.

For example, if competitors are being mentioned for prompts related to AI visibility but a business is not, the issue may be weak content depth, weak content mapping, low brand recognition, or unclear service positioning. By reviewing these gaps, the business can strengthen its content plan and build stronger authority in the areas that matter most.
